As the holy month of Ramadan approaches, Yardım Köprüsü Association is preparing to launch a package of humanitarian projects in both Gaza and Syria, aiming to alleviate the suffering of vulnerable families and support them during this blessed month that embodies the values of compassion and solidarity.
These preparations come amid difficult humanitarian conditions faced by thousands of families, as the impacts of ongoing crises continue to affect daily life and deepen poverty and need—particularly among widows, children, and the elderly.
This year’s Ramadan projects include the distribution of food parcels to meet families’ basic needs, alongside Ramadan iftar meals intended to bring warmth and reassurance to fasting households, especially in the most affected areas. The projects also feature Eid clothing to restore a sense of joy for children who have been deprived of it, in addition to fresh vegetable parcels to support food security and improve dietary diversity for beneficiary families.
The association places special emphasis on supporting widows, providing assistance that helps them cope with life’s challenges and meet their families’ needs, based on the belief that empowering and supporting women is a cornerstone of community resilience.
